AFIC Provides Estimated NTA Backing as of Early July 2026<\/h2>
Australian Foundation Investment Company Limited (AFIC) has revealed its estimated net tangible asset (NTA) backing per share as at July 3, 2026. The pre-tax NTA per share is estimated to be $7.96. This unaudited figure offers a preliminary view of the company’s asset value prior to accounting for deferred tax on unrealised gains or losses.<\/p>

Share Price in Relation to Estimated NTA<\/h2>
On July 3, 2026, AFIC’s closing share price stood at $6.88, which is below the estimated pre-tax NTA per share of $7.96. This suggests the market is pricing the shares at a discount compared to the company’s asset backing, a factor that may interest investors considering potential share price realignment.<\/p>
Investors frequently analyze the gap between NTA and share price to understand market sentiment and identify investment opportunities. A share price below NTA can indicate undervaluation, whereas a share price above NTA may imply overvaluation.<\/p>
The Role of NTA in Investment Evaluation<\/h2>
The net tangible asset backing per share is a pivotal metric for investors, reflecting an estimate of the value of a company’s tangible assets on a per-share basis. Intangible assets are excluded, offering a conservative valuation of the company’s worth. For AFIC, the NTA serves as a key indicator of financial stability and asset management performance.<\/p>
Investors use NTA to compare a company’s intrinsic value against its market price. When NTA exceeds the share price, it can signal a buying opportunity; conversely, a lower NTA might lead investors to reassess expected returns.<\/p>
